В классической работе П. Хопкирка описаны два века противостояния (от эпохи Петра I до Николая II) между двумя великими державами — Англией и Россией — в Центральной Азии, анализируются их геополитические цели в этом огромном регионе. Показана острейшая тайная и явная борьба за территории, влияние и рынки. Изложена история войн России и последовательного покорения ею владений эмиров и ханов — Ташкента, Самарканда, Бухары, Хивы, Коканда, Геок‑Тепе, Мерва… захвата афганского Панджшеха, районов Памира. Ярко описаны удивительные и драматические приключения выдающихся участников Большой Игры — офицеров, агентов и добровольных исследователей (русских и англичан), многие из которых трагически погибли.

BIBLIOGRAPHY

The literature of the Great Game, in all its many aspects, is vast. The following list of titles, although far from exhaustive, includes those works which I found most valuable while researching and writing this book. Many of the books are long out of print, and can only be obtained from specialist libraries — or at great expense. The Afghan wars, the Crimean War, the Eastern Question, Anglo‑Russian relations and the Russo‑Japanese War, although inseparable from the Great Game, are major subjects on their own, with substantial literatures devoted to them. I have therefore listed only those works which I found most useful. Also, for the sake of brevity, I have omitted reports and articles from contemporary newspapers from which I have quoted, although these are usually identified in the text. For the same reason, and because they are unlikely to interest the general reader, I have not listed the file numbers where I have drawn on the Political and Secret files of the day, now in the India Office Library and Records. Except where otherwise indicated, all the works below were published in London.
